Ethylene Vinyl Acetate (EVA) has transformed the footwear and sports equipment industry, providing lightweight, durable, and flexible materials essential for comfort, performance, and safety. EVA foam, in particular, is widely used in midsoles, insoles, outsoles, and cushioning components, offering shock absorption, energy return, and ergonomic design possibilities.
In athletic footwear, EVA’s lightweight nature reduces fatigue during prolonged use, while its flexibility accommodates a wide range of foot movements. The polymer’s cushioning properties protect joints and muscles from impact stress, making it ideal for running shoes, trainers, and sports-specific footwear. EVA’s resistance to cracking and deformation ensures long-term durability, even under rigorous athletic conditions.
Casual footwear and sandals also benefit from EVA foam. Its moldability allows for innovative designs and personalized comfort, while its softness enhances overall user experience. EVA’s waterproof nature prevents moisture absorption, keeping footwear lightweight and comfortable in wet conditions. Moreover, its hypoallergenic and non-toxic properties make it safe for consumers of all ages.
Beyond footwear, EVA market share is extensively used in sports equipment. Protective gear, mats, and padding utilize EVA foam for impact absorption and flexibility, ensuring safety during high-intensity activities. The material’s resilience allows repeated compression without loss of shape, making it suitable for gym mats, helmets, and protective pads. EVA’s shock-absorbing capability is crucial for preventing injuries in contact sports.
The growing health and fitness trend worldwide, coupled with rising demand for performance-oriented and comfort-focused footwear, continues to drive EVA adoption. Manufacturers are experimenting with innovative EVA composites, integrating other materials to enhance energy return, durability, and environmental sustainability. EVA-based recyclable foams and bio-based variants are gaining traction, aligning with eco-conscious consumer preferences.
In addition, technological advancements in EVA processing, such as injection molding and compression molding, enable precise control over density, hardness, and cushioning properties. This allows footwear designers to create customized solutions for different activities, from running and basketball to hiking and casual wear. The versatility and adaptability of EVA ensure that it remains a dominant material in the global footwear and sports market.
